Navigating Loneliness and Anger: How Mindfulness Empowers Men

Navigating Loneliness and Anger: How Mindfulness Empowers Men


The Unseen Battle: Understanding Loneliness in Men

Loneliness isn't always synonymous with being alone. Many men grapple with feelings of isolation even when surrounded by family or colleagues. This pervasive sense of disconnection can quietly seep into everyday life, often manifesting in anger and frustration when not properly addressed. A busy work schedule or evolving responsibilities may erode the very friendships that once provided support, creating emotional isolation that goes unnoticed until it’s too late.

Why Anger is Often Misunderstood

For many men, anger serves as more than just an emotional response; it often masks deeper feelings of sadness, shame, or the burden of unprocessed grief. The pressure to appear strong and self-sufficient can lead men to internalize their emotions, resulting in explosive reactions to seemingly trivial stimuli. Such misinterpretations of anger can occur frequently, particularly in instances where unresolved issues linger beneath the surface, impacting relationships and overall mental health.

Mindfulness: A Tool for Healing

In recent years, mindfulness practices have gained traction as an essential component of emotional and mental wellness. Mindfulness isn't about achieving a quiet mind but developing an acute awareness of one's emotional landscape. By fostering this awareness, men can create a vital space between their feelings and reactions — a space that allows for thoughtful responses rather than impulsive reactions to stress.

Practical Mindfulness Techniques for Men

Consider the '3-Breath Reset' technique: taking a moment to pause and focus on your breathing can have transformative effects on your emotional state. By inhaling deeply, holding for a moment, and exhaling slowly, you’ll allow yourself to recognize the physiological signals of stress — such as tension or a racing heart — before they escalate into rash actions. This exercise not only promotes emotional regulation but also empowers men to realize they are not alone in their struggles.

The Power of Support Systems

Recognizing and building a strong support system is crucial. Many men feel they cannot share their vulnerabilities due to fear of judgment or a lack of safe spaces for expression. Cultivating friendships and connections rooted in empathy allows men to engage openly about their mental health, leading to reduced feelings of loneliness and enhancing overall well-being. Sharing experiences diminishes the load of solitary struggles and fosters a community that supports mental wellness.

Future Perspectives on Men's Mental Health

As society slowly shifts towards recognizing the importance of mental health, mindfulness and empathetic communication will likely become mainstays in healthcare practices catering to men. The normalization of emotions as a human experience is vital. Beyond enforcing traditional masculine norms, healthcare providers are encouraged to foster environments where men feel safe to express emotional distress, thereby improving their mental health outcomes.

Conclusion: Actionable Steps Towards Wellness

Men grappling with loneliness and anger should take proactive steps towards wellness by integrating mindfulness into their lives and seeking meaningful connections. Be it through personal reflections or open discussions, embracing emotional experiences is not a weakness; it’s a pathway towards resilience and fulfillment. Encourage the men in your life to explore these approaches and remind them that seeking help is a sign of strength.
